Rocket Ships
Good news! You don't need to get the 4th 'extra' rocket to earn these achievements, so you can take as long as you need in each park without worrying about a time-limit. There's actually no achievement at all for getting the extra 4th rocket ships.

Themed Exhibits
The theme items are expensive ($50K each) which is the only thing that will slow you down here. Click on an exhibit, set a "theme" and then review the requirements. You must set a thee, meet all the requirements AND have the theme item in exhibit.

Prehistoric
Build an exhibit with a Prehistoric theme
  • Meet size requirements
  • All plants require water
  • Realism must be at maximum (Unlock the Forest Pack, Mud Pack, and Sand Pack to access the prehistoric plants to meet this requirement. Plants will then show up under Trees/Bushes as Tier 2 plants)
  • Volcano theme item
Theme bonus
  • 30% more appeal in this exhibit
  • Dinos in this exhibit do not become sick
  • Volcanos are active in this exhibit

Secure
Build an exhibit with a Secure theme
  • Meet size requirements
  • All plants require water
  • All fences must be at maximum strength
  • Security Camera theme item
Theme bonus
  • 20% more appeal in this exhibit
  • Stronger fences
  • Alarms activate when dino is loose

Organic
Build an exhibit with a Organic theme
  • Meet size requirements
  • All plants require water
  • Have perfect Biodiversity
  • Windmill theme item
Theme bonus
  • 30% more appeal in this exhibit
  • Poop disappears
  • Butterflies appear in this exhibit

Eden
Build an exhibit with a Eden theme
  • Meet size requirements
  • All plants require water
  • No viewing spots
  • Mother Tree theme item
Theme bonus
  • 20% more appeal in this exhibit
  • Happiness requirement for Dino Nest is much lower
  • Rainbows appear in this exhibit

Spooky
Build an exhibit with a Spooky theme
  • Meet size requirements
  • All plants require water
  • Only carnivores in this exhibit
  • Skull Tree theme item
Theme bonus
  • 20% more appeal in this exhibit
  • 30% more donations from this exhibit
  • Fog appears in this exhibit

Magical
Build an exhibit with a Magical theme
  • Meet size requirements
  • All plants require water
  • Only herbivores in this exhibit
  • Magical Tower theme item
Theme bonus
  • 20% more appeal in this exhibit
  • Dinos require less food
  • Fireflies appear in this exhibit

  • Perfection
    Create a perfect Habitat for one of your Dinos
    Tip: Make sure the habitat size is big enough for the amount of dinos inside. Place enough food and toys. Have the correct type & amount of Trees, Bushes, and Rocks. Have a mate of the opposite sex. Place plenty of tall grass for hiding, as well as, using fencing with higher privacy rating to reduce dino stress.

  • Dinosaur Tycoon
    Complete the Dinosaur Tycoon challenge
    Tip: From the initial home screen, select the Customize section, then under the Mode dropdown you will find Dinosaur Tycoon. You need to achieve a Park Appeal of 50,000 + have 300 guests. This is basically the game on HARD MODE as supplies have higher prices and dinosaurs needs are more demanding.
    My advice is to focus on breeding dinos with higher appeal.
    • Unlock the Dinosaur Nest, DNA Machine, and Chrono Eggcelerator. Place the later 2 anywhere in the park.
    • Place at least 2 dino eggs in an exhibit. You'll need to pay close attention to the eggs. You need to click the eggs when they are developing but NOT ready to hatch. If they are ready to hatch, you've missed your chance to upgrade the stats.
    • Once eggs have been laid, make sure you have a female and a male. Click an egg to check the sex, you can change the sex of an egg from the Scan tab.
    • At the top of the egg window, there are 3 empty boxes (1 white and 2 blue). In the blue boxes, place a Rare Gem and a hat with high +Appeal (FYI, placing a hat in the white box of an egg will change the Primary color of the dino).
      • The Coyboy hat is a rare drop with +160 Appeal.
      • The Wizard hat is a rare drop with +120 Appeal and No Poop feature.
      • The Mushroom hat can be bought at the hat store and has +80 appeal and the friendly status.
      • The Kimmy hat is the same as the Mushroom hat but is acquired from digging.
    • Hatch the egss and remove the adult dinos from the exhibit, then wait for the babies to grow up and put hats with high appeal on them.
